管道检测中伪随机码技术应用研究

摘    要:将伪随机码技术引入管道检测,通过对伪随机码信号的分析,提出根据接收信号幅频特性中的幅度相差23 dB的频率点及环境的其他参数,计算出管道绝缘电阻的参数,从而确定管道腐蚀状况的一种新方法,经过仿真和实验验证了伪随机码在管道检测中应用的可行性。

关 键 词:管道检测  PN码  信号处理  同步

Research of the Pseudo Noise Code in Pipeline's Detection

Abstract:In the situation of nondestructive pipes,a new method was presented in this paper.The technique of pseudo noise code was introduced.Through the change of pseudo noise code in the course of receiving and other signals based on detection conditions,we can analyze the status of underground lines.The principle of this system was analyzed and was simulated.The result shows that the design is reasonable.
Keywords:pipeline's detection  pseudo noise code  signal process  synchronization
